Understanding the Publishing Process

The publishing process typically begins with the selection of a suitable journal. Authors must consider factors such as the journal’s impact factor, scope, and audience to ensure that their work is a good fit. Once a journal is selected, authors must prepare their manuscript according to the journal’s guidelines and submit it for review. The review process can be lengthy, with some journals taking several months to a year or more to make a decision.

Key Factors in Publishing Success

Several factors contribute to publishing success, including the quality of the research, the clarity and concision of the writing, and the relevance of the topic to the journal’s audience. High-quality research is essential, as it provides the foundation for a compelling and meaningful paper. Clear and concise writing is also crucial, as it enables readers to understand the research and its significance. Finally, relevance to the journal’s audience is critical, as it ensures that the paper will be of interest to the journal’s readers.

Preparing a Manuscript for Submission

Preparing a manuscript for submission involves several steps, including writing and revising the manuscript, editing and proofreading, and formatting the manuscript according to the journal’s guidelines. Writing and revising the manuscript is a critical step, as it enables authors to refine their ideas and ensure that the manuscript is well-organized and clearly written. Editing and proofreading are also essential, as they help to eliminate errors and improve the clarity and concision of the writing.

Tips for Writing a Successful Manuscript

The following tips can help authors write a successful manuscript:

  • Start with a clear and concise title that reflects the main theme of the paper
  • Use a clear and concise writing style that is free of jargon and technical terms
  • Organize the manuscript logically, with a clear introduction, methods, results, and discussion
  • Use headings and subheadings to help readers navigate the manuscript
  • Use tables and figures to illustrate key findings and support the text

Responding to Reviewer Comments

Responding to reviewer comments is a critical step in the publishing process. Authors must carefully review the comments, revise the manuscript accordingly, and submit a revised version to the journal. Addressing reviewer comments is essential, as it enables authors to refine their ideas and ensure that the manuscript is well-organized and clearly written. Revising the manuscript is also crucial, as it helps to eliminate errors and improve the clarity and concision of the writing.

Tips for Responding to Reviewer Comments

The following tips can help authors respond to reviewer comments:

  1. Read the comments carefully and understand the reviewer's concerns
  2. Address each comment in the response letter, providing a clear and concise explanation of the revisions made
  3. Revise the manuscript accordingly, making sure to address all of the reviewer's concerns
  4. Submit a revised version of the manuscript to the journal, along with a response letter that addresses the reviewer's comments
